1. PA612 158L Grade Basic Descriptiona.Base resin: PA612 (long carbon chain low-moisture-absorption nylon)
b.158: Medium-viscosity base PA612 resin
c.L: Built-in general-purpose lubricant formulation for improved demolding, wear resistance and flowability
d.NC010: Natural unpigmented pellets, free of carbon black and colorants

Thermal Properties
a.HDT at 0.45 MPa: 218℃
b.HDT at 1.82 MPa: 210℃
c.Recommended melt processing temperature range: 230~290℃, optimum at 250℃
d.Mold temperature: 50~90℃, constant 70℃ is recommended
3. PA612 158L Key Grade Characteristics1.Medium viscosity with internal lubricationBalances mold filling and mechanical strength; self-lubricating and wear-resistant, ideal for slides, gears and bushings with smooth movement and low mold sticking risk; no extra external mold release agent required.
2.Low water absorption & excellent dimensional stabilityMuch lower moisture uptake than PA6 and PA66, resulting in minimal dimensional fluctuation under humid conditions, suitable for precision small mechanical components.
3.Broad chemical resistanceResistant to engine oil, grease, alcohol, weak acids & alkalis, and general cleaning agents; applicable to automotive fuel and hydraulic small parts.
4.Dual processing compatibilityCapable of injection molding various structural parts, as well as extrusion for tubes, rods, monofilaments and cable coatings.
5.No dedicated medical complianceOnly basic FDA food contact certification available; without ISO 10993, USP Class VI biocompatibility certifications, not allowed for implantable devices or medical instruments requiring repeated sterilization.
4. PA612 158L Standard Injection Molding Processing Guidelines1.Drying: Dehumidified hot air drying at 80℃ for 2~4 hours; optimal moisture content ≤0.1%, maximum acceptable 0.15% to avoid silver streaks and hydrolysis embrittlement.
2.Barrel temperature profile: 235~255℃, nozzle temperature +5~10℃ higher.
3.Constant mold temperature at 70℃ to enhance surface gloss and uniform crystallization.
4.Screw residence time: 3~5 minutes ideal; never exceed 10 minutes to prevent thermal degradation and discoloration.
5.Molding parameters: Medium-high injection speed for filling, moderate holding pressure to reduce internal stress and warpage.
5. PA612 158L Typical Applications (Industrial & Automotive Focus)1.Automotive: Fuel line connectors, tubing liners, gears, sliding latches for door & window, oil pump components
2.General machinery: Wear-resistant slides, small gears, bearing bushings, precision valve seats, pneumatic parts
3.Extruded products: PA612 tubing, rods, fine filaments, cable coatings
4.General food-contact small parts (non-sterilization ambient-use only)
5.Sanitary ware, cosmetic pump bodies and sliding structures (ambient use only, not for repeated high-temperature disinfection)
